1. Open a Logger window - under the GUI "Tools" menu - click "Messages"
and then  set "verbosity Level" to 2.  When you play a station that
works - save the log and post it. This is the GUI version of what my
vlcdebug bat files do.

2. The GUI basically makes up commands and then passes them to a
command line interface. To find out the exact command the GUI sends.  I
presume you have been using the "Media" menu and then "Open Capture
device". When in this menu - Check the "show more options" at bottom
left.  An extension will open showing the command line options that
will be used.  Choose the capture device that works and then copy to a
post the command line that shows at the bottom.
